The article investigates how corporate legitimacy operates as the motivational substructure of impression management (IM) in post-crisis communication. It inspects how organizations try to re-create legitimacy after crises that differ in moral severity, distinguishing between endogenous (preventable) and exogenous (systemic) disorders. Results reveal a relevant transformation in corporate discourse. After the Concordia disaster, the company mainly adopted defensive and corrective responses, focusing on procedural control and on restoring cognitive legitimacy. The moral dimension of the crisis was reframed in managerial terms. During the COVID-19 crisis, the tone changed. Communication became more assertive and moral, stressing empathy, solidarity, and alignment with public institutions
